可视化平台设计如何适应不同设备和屏幕尺寸?

在当今这个数字化时代,可视化平台已经成为企业、组织和个人展示信息、数据分析、交互体验的重要工具。然而,随着移动设备的普及和屏幕尺寸的多样化,如何设计一个能够适应不同设备和屏幕尺寸的可视化平台,成为了一个亟待解决的问题。本文将深入探讨可视化平台设计如何适应不同设备和屏幕尺寸,以期为相关从业者提供有益的参考。

一、响应式设计

响应式设计是适应不同设备和屏幕尺寸的关键。它通过使用弹性布局、媒体查询等技术,使页面能够根据不同设备的屏幕尺寸自动调整布局和内容。以下是响应式设计的关键点:

  1. 弹性布局:采用弹性布局可以使页面元素在不同屏幕尺寸下保持良好的视觉效果。例如,使用百分比、视口单位(vw、vh)等替代固定像素单位,使元素宽度、高度和间距随屏幕尺寸变化而变化。

  2. 媒体查询:通过媒体查询,可以为不同屏幕尺寸设置不同的样式。例如,针对手机屏幕,可以设置字体大小、颜色、图片尺寸等,以优化用户体验。

  3. 自适应图片:针对不同设备屏幕尺寸,使用自适应图片技术,使图片能够根据屏幕宽度自动调整大小,避免图片拉伸或压缩。

二、适配不同操作系统和浏览器

除了响应式设计,可视化平台还需要适配不同操作系统和浏览器。以下是一些适配策略:

  1. 兼容性测试:在开发过程中,对主流操作系统和浏览器进行兼容性测试,确保平台在不同设备和浏览器上正常运行。

  2. 跨平台框架:使用跨平台框架,如React Native、Flutter等,可以减少开发成本,提高开发效率。

  3. 渐进增强:在开发过程中,优先考虑主流设备和浏览器的兼容性,然后逐步增强功能,以满足特定设备和浏览器的需求。

三、优化用户体验

为了提高用户体验,可视化平台设计应遵循以下原则:

  1. 简洁明了:界面设计应简洁明了,避免冗余信息,使用户能够快速找到所需内容。

  2. 交互友好:提供便捷的交互方式,如滑动、缩放、拖拽等,使用户能够轻松操作。

  3. 加载速度:优化页面加载速度,减少等待时间,提高用户体验。

  4. 个性化推荐:根据用户行为和喜好,提供个性化推荐,使用户能够快速找到感兴趣的内容。

四、案例分析

以下是一些成功适应不同设备和屏幕尺寸的可视化平台案例:

  1. 百度地图:百度地图采用响应式设计,在不同设备和屏幕尺寸下都能提供良好的用户体验。

  2. 腾讯新闻:腾讯新闻使用React Native框架,实现跨平台开发,同时针对不同设备和屏幕尺寸进行优化。

  3. 支付宝:支付宝在移动端采用简洁明了的界面设计,同时提供丰富的交互方式,满足用户在不同场景下的需求。

总之,设计一个能够适应不同设备和屏幕尺寸的可视化平台,需要综合考虑响应式设计、适配不同操作系统和浏览器、优化用户体验等因素。通过不断优化和改进,可视化平台将为用户提供更加便捷、高效的信息展示和交互体验。

猜你喜欢:云原生NPM